Researchers Develop Quantitative Measure of VR Sickness

DAEJEON, March 19 (Korea Bizwire) — A research team from the Korea Research Institute of Standards and Science (KRISS) said Thursday that it had developed new technology that can quantitatively measure the degree of virtual reality (VR) sickness. New Technology Helps Reduce Nausea That Can Occur During VR Gameplay

DAEJEON, Nov. 27 (Korea Bizwire) — A South Korean research team has developed new technology that helps people enjoy virtual reality (VR) content without feeling nausea and dizziness. Institute Develops VR-based Fire Extinguishing Training Simulator

DAEJEON, Sept. 24 (Korea Bizwire) — The state-run Electronics and Telecommunications Research Institute (ETRI) announced on Wednesday that it has developed a virtual reality (VR) fire extinguishing training simulator that allows firefighters to be trained in real-like fire environments. LG Uplus Forms AR, VR Alliance with Global Telcos and Qualcomm

SEOUL, Sept. 2 (Korea Bizwire) — LG Uplus Corp., South Korea’s No. 3 mobile carrier, said Tuesday it has formed an alliance with global telecom operators, content developers and U.S. chipmaker Qualcomm Technologies Inc. to develop 5G-based augmented reality (AR) and virtual reality (VR) content to boost the budding industry.
